SJVN has reported results for first quarter ended June 30, 2016.
The company has reported 0.97% fall in its net profit at Rs 479.96 crore for the quarter ended June 30, 2016 as compared to Rs 484.67 crore for the same quarter in the previous year. The company’s total income increased marginally by 0.84% to Rs 886.68 crore for the quarter under review from Rs 879.26 crore for the corresponding quarter of the previous year.
SJVN is a joint venture between the Central government and Himachal Pradesh state government. The company owns and operates India’s largest 1500 MW Nathpa Jhakri Hydro Power Station in Himachal Pradesh.
